原创 List --- ArrayList源碼解析

  本文采用的是jdk1.8,分析ArrayList常用的方法源碼;如有錯誤,請指出,謝謝   一,ArrayList的關係圖 在我們日常開發階段,ArrayList是我們用的非常非常多的一個集合,帶來了很大的便利,下面開始分析Arra

原创 驗證碼登錄功能--Cookie&&Session實現

1,驗證碼的文本:new_words.txt 一唱一和 一呼百應 一乾二淨 一舉兩得 一落千丈 一模一樣 一暴十寒 一日千里 一五一十 一心一意 兩面三刀 2,驗證碼的Servlet類:CheckImgServlet package

原创 mysql數據庫(1)---簡單查詢【入門1】

建表語句 emp表: CREATE TABLE `emp`(     `empNo` INT(10) NOT NULL,     `ename` VARCHAR(10) DEFAULT NULL,     `job` VARCHAR(1

原创 jsp實現-登錄狀態響應,商品列表展示---el&jstl

  登錄前: 圖 登錄 登陸後   代碼實現--登錄狀態和商品列表展示 1登錄 LoginServlet //只獲取用戶名,不獲取密碼驗證等等 String username = request.getParameter("us

原创 HttpServletResponse響應

  【1】我們在創建Servlet時會覆蓋service()方法,或doGet()/doPost(),這些方法都有兩個參數,一個爲代表請求的request和代表 響應response。 service方法中的response的類型是Ser

原创 mysql數據庫(2)---單行函數、多行函數、分組查詢【入門2】

數據庫處理函數-- 單行函數、多行函數 -- 概念:數據庫函數類似於Java中的方法,可以接受一個或多個參數,在函數內部完成計算,並且最終返回結果 -- 使用函數的注意事項:   -- 1,使用函數的時候是把查詢結果當作參數輸入給函數,所

原创 Linux下搭建redis3.0集羣----10分鐘內完成搭建

前言:本文章是從0到1,一步一步搭建起redis集羣 本集羣採用的是同一臺服務器192.168.116.128 一,第一步下載redis 1.1先關閉防火牆 //臨時關閉 systemctl stop firewalld //禁

原创 redis-簡單配置主從複製

前言:本文章是使用虛擬機進行部署redis的主從複製,關於虛擬機的安裝可以看我這篇文章 【centos7下載和VMware Workstation15版本下載和註冊碼】https://blog.csdn.net/wssc63262/art

原创 Idea使用Spring initializr搭建Maven的父工程和子項目

本教程是使用Idea下使用spring initializr去搭建Maven工程多項目,也是搭建SpringCloud的多項目教程   1.搭建父項目 1.1首先在建立一個空的文件目錄(選擇性可以建也可以不建) 1.2可以看到空文件夾的

原创 centos7下載和VMware Workstation15版本下載和註冊碼

一.centos7下載 本次下載只推薦在阿里雲,因爲比較快 阿里雲站點:http://mirrors.aliyun.com/centos/7/isos/x86_64/ 各個版本的ISO鏡像文件說明: CentOS-7-x86_64-DV

原创 mysql數據庫的優化

1.MySQL如何優化 表的設計合理化(符合數據庫三大範式) 添加適當索引【四種:普通索引、主鍵索引、唯一索引unique、全文索引】 SQL語句的優化 分表技術(水平分割、垂直分割) 讀寫 [寫:update/delete/add/se

原创 SpringBoot+LayUI動態展示側邊導航欄

採用springboot+mybatis+layui搭建一個動態的側邊導航欄 1.動態展示導航欄的數據如下圖 json數據 思想:前端使用layui的標籤屬性獲取到數據,用js進行拼接,展示到頁面 2.主要頁面代碼 Navigatio

原创 記錄springBoot2.1.1版本里添加thymeleaf-extras-springsecurity4後,也無法正常讀取到sec標籤

所遇到的錯誤 由於我是選擇默認SpringBoot最新版本2.1.1 頁面無法讀取到sec:authorize="isAnonymous()"和sec:authorize="isAuthenticated()" 甚至sec標籤頁不做解析

原创 SpringBoot2.0以上整合elasticsearch報錯

遇到的錯誤· failed to load elasticsearch nodes : org.elasticsearch.client.transport.NoNodeAvailableException: None of the c

原创 mysql數據庫(3)--內,外連接查詢、子查詢、合併、分頁【入門3】

可以參照前兩個帖子,按順序的,mysql數據庫(1)有完整的建表語句 mysql數據庫(1)---簡單查詢 mysql數據庫(2)---單行函數、多行函數、分組查詢   -- 簡單查詢語句的完整語法 /*完整語法 SELECT 查詢列表